How they compare
Spain currently reports 0.0409 units per person against 0.0335 units per person in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income), a difference of 0.0074 units per person.
That makes Spain's figure about 1.2 times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income)'s.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Spain ahead.
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) ranks 6th and Spain ranks 8th of 43 groups.
Spain has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income) | Spain |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 0.0246 units per person | 0.03 units per person | 0.0054 units per person | Spain |
| 1970s | 0.0301 units per person | 0.0322 units per person | 0.0022 units per person | Spain |
| 1980s | 0.0276 units per person | 0.0284 units per person | 0.0007 units per person | Spain |
| 1990s | 0.0239 units per person | 0.0301 units per person | 0.0061 units per person | Spain |
| 2000s | 0.0322 units per person | 0.0343 units per person | 0.0021 units per person | Spain |
| 2010s | 0.0321 units per person | 0.0394 units per person | 0.0074 units per person | Spain |
| 2020s | 0.0324 units per person | 0.041 units per person | 0.0086 units per person | Spain |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
